Andre Agassi will play his first pro pickleball tournament with Anna Leigh Waters at the U.S. Open Pickleball Championships.
Pickleball has exploded in popularity, growing 311% over the past three years and becoming the fastest-growing sport in the U.S.
Waters earned more than $3 million playing pickleball in 2024, showcasing the sport's increasing financial opportunities.
Agassi's participation aims to grow the sport, leveraging his star power to attract new audiences.
Agassi has partnered with Joola and serves as the inaugural chair of Life Time’s pickleball and tennis board.

Andre Agassi's move to professional pickleball highlights the sport's surging popularity and increasing appeal to athletes from other disciplines. Pickleball, invented in 1965, has seen a massive increase in participation, driven by its accessibility, social nature, and relatively low barrier to entry.
Agassi, a former world No. 1 tennis player with eight Grand Slam titles, has embraced pickleball after retiring from tennis. His partnership with Anna Leigh Waters, the top-ranked pickleball player in the world, underscores the sport's growing profile and attractiveness to high-profile athletes.
The U.S. Open Pickleball Championships, founded in 2016, attracts up to 50,000 fans annually, demonstrating the sport's expanding fanbase and commercial potential. Pickleball players are now earning more than WNBA and NWSL players, reflecting the sport's increasing financial viability.
Agassi's involvement is not just about playing; he's also actively promoting the sport through partnerships and board positions, signaling a long-term commitment to pickleball's growth.
